Jupiters compared to VCaps
12/28/22 at 18:21:29
 
I bought a 2nd Rachael amp that came with VCaps and have done a side by side test now that the VCaps have some time on them with my stock (pre Jupiter) Rachael.  I think the VCaps bring a lot to the table.

Anyone have experience with both caps that could offer an opinion on their signatures?  I am thinking of upgrading the stock Rachael and trying to decide between the two.

I've had experience with both Jupiters and V-Caps but not in the same piece. Both my Torii Mk IV and my SE34i.2+ had the Jupiters, and I installed Jupiters in my Jolida JD-9. My Atma-Sphere MP-3 came with V-Caps, and my Atma-Sphere M-60s were upgraded with V-Caps along with the other 3.3 level changes by Ralph.

Lon's description is pretty apt, although I'd say the V-Caps provide a great deal more detail than the Jupiters, especially inner detail, without really giving up much liquidity. The V-Caps reveal much more of the differences between tubes, which is not always a good thing. The Jupiters made a huge difference in the Jolida, but it had really cheap caps from the factory. I'm guessing Steve uses better quality caps as his standard, so the difference with the Jupiters might not be as great.

Bottom line is either are a huge improvement compared to any low end cap. Hard to go wrong with either.
